New experiments and ACEOs

I love the graphic effect of linocuts. The lines are very bold and I find the stark contrast of black and white as well as the interplay of negative and positive space to be most interesting. I also love it when the color element is added as the colors seem brighter and the work has this "comic book" effect to it. I am in the position where I do not have the facilities or equipment (inks, press, linoleum) to recreate this method any time soon. So I improvised and created the following piece.





On the back of the card, I affixed the queen of spades playing card. I've been meaning to use these for ACEOs for awhile now and thought my little experiment here would be the perfect compliment. This is called a gouache relief and the resemblance to a hand-painted lino is uncanny to say the least. It is a beautiful process, albeit time consuming. I wouldn't say it is for the perfectionist especially since the effects are somewhat unpredictable.

Mali Girl Completed, Maine Coons WIP




I have finally completed Mali Girl. I completed this for an event I have coming up in March. I'm rather pleased with the results. It was completed in gold acrylic, archival proof ink and watercolor on 140 lb Arches Watercolor paper. The original scan I had brightened a little bit because it scanned really dim. I then glazed over the original in a reddish tone to brighten the face. This scan is unaltered.

I am still working on the Maine Coon kittens. Eventually I will get them completed :-). These are graphite on 140 lb Strathmore paper (I think it responds to the graphite better than the Arches).
